OverviewSummary updated

FoothillsTruck is the subject of a court-appointed receivership in the Court of King's Bench of Alberta, brought under section 243 of the Bankruptcy and Insolvency Act together with provincial Judicature Act authority and carried on court file 2401-07573. The proceeding was commenced on June 27, 2024 with the filing of the receivership application. That filing is the only step captured on this record, which now lists the matter as closed. No subsequent orders, reports or hearings have been recorded here.

Capital structureAs asserted in the filings
Priority classCreditorAmountSource
SecuredRoyal Bank of Canada · in 556 casesGeneral Security Agreement (GSA) dated March 5, 2021; GSA – Floating Charge on Land dated November 16, 2021 — Demand letter dated March 7, 2024 stated CAD $1,811,276.87 as of March 1, 2024, plus accruing interest, costs and legal fees (also cited in 244 Notice of same date). Excludes CEBA loan of $60,237.71 (as of March 7, 2024), stated to be dealt with separately. — debtor: Foothills Truck Sales & Services Ltd. · as of 28 May 2024$1.9MAffidavit of Marlene Starenky, sworn June 24, 2024

This proceeding was commenced by a secured creditor. The record does not include the debtor’s own statement of assets and liabilities — that ceiling is the record’s, not this page’s.
